## Hermetic Build Migration — On-Call Notes

We are mid-migration from the legacy Makewright scripts to the hermetic Stonebuild system. During the transition, both pipelines run in parallel and write artifact checksums to a shared comparison database. If you're paged for a checksum mismatch, first confirm both builds completed, then diff the recorded hashes. To query the comparison records directly, connect using the connection string below.

primary connection of yagep-kahip = redis://giliel_svc:zYiKsLL2PLpfPL@db-348f.xolmarsys.corp:5432/fenwyn

Subject: DR Drill — Restoring tailcat Access

Maintainers: during next week's disaster-recovery drill for Orvalle, the internal log-tailing CLI (tailcat) will lose its broker credentials on purpose. Follow the restore doc in order: re-register the broker endpoint, verify the read-only scope, and confirm tailing resumes on the Denwick shard. When the restore wizard asks for credentials, use the recovery passphrase below.

unlock words, kagef-taduf: fenir-quenix-norwyn-sorvan-gormir-gorir-fraok

## Recovering your StageGrid plugin account

If you've lost access to your StageGrid developer seat, don't panic — the seat-map renderer config is versioned server-side, so your theatre layouts for the Orpheum Vale project are safe. First, try the self-serve reset from the plugin portal. If that bounces you back to the login screen twice, you'll need the offline recovery path instead. Grab the recovery kit from your team lead, open the sealed section, and enter the passphrase exactly as printed below.

unlock words, hahip-baduf: holwyn-istath-julvan

Fan-out backpressure for the Quillet notifier: when the queue depth crosses the soft limit, the dispatcher sheds low-priority pushes and batches the rest at 500ms intervals. Reviewer should confirm the shed counter is exported and that retries respect the jitter window. Once merged, the release artifact gets re-signed by the pipeline, which expects the deploy key shown below.

deploy key for bawep-yawif: bky6_GQhaSt